Rímur af Finnboga Ramma

  • Ólafur Halldórsson

Abstract

The Faroese Finnboga ríma is based on chapters 12-17 of Finnboga saga ramma, with the natural adjustments that Finnbogi is said to be Faroese and that the action is made to take place in the Faroes and Norway. In these chapters there are motifs whichs also appear in Hallfreðar saga, Áns saga bogsveigis, Kjalnesinga saga, Vilmundar saga viðutan and others. Finnboga ríma deviates from the saga at a number of points. Where this occurs there is a blatant similarity between the ríma and corresponding episodes in Áns rímur bogsveigis and Ormur's Vilmundar rímur viðutan (VO.). It is possible that the Faroese Finnboga ríma was based on Icelandic Finnboga rímur, now lost, which were younger than Ans rímur and partially dependant on them, but older than VO., in which case stanza VII 67 in VO. might be derived from the postulated lost Finnboga rímur, in partially or completely unchanged form.
